A well-established, family-run retailer is expanding its team and seeking a confident, service-driven Sales Advisor for their showroom in the local area. Known for delivering exceptional customer experiences and premium quality products, this growing business is looking for someone who thrives in a busy, customer-focused environment.
You'll play a key role in delivering outstanding service throughout the full customer journey – from initial enquiry through to aftersales care. This is a varied position combining showroom-based sales, technical advice, administration, and customer support both in person and over the phone/email.
Description of the role:- Engage with customers in the showroom and over phone/email to guide them through the sales process.
- Provide tailored advice on products, technical suitability, sizing, and design.
- Create quotations, process payments, arrange deliveries, and resolve customer queries.
- Manage sample requests and follow up with prospective customers.
- Maintain accurate customer records in the CRM system.
- Ensure the showroom remains tidy, welcoming, and well-presented.
- Confirm showroom appointments and prepare refreshments for visitors.
- Make proactive follow-up calls to clients and handle all incoming enquiries efficiently.
- Minimum 2 years' experience in a customer-facing sales or retail role.
- Strong communication skills with excellent attention to detail.
- Experience using a CRM system and Microsoft Office.
- Highly organised with the 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ced setting.
- A proactive, hands-on attitude.
- Experience in the luxury or premium retail market is a bonus.

How to prepare for a job interview at fabric recruitment
✨Showcase Your Customer Service Skills
As a Sales Advisor, your ability to engage with customers is crucial.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you provided exceptional service, resolved issues, or went above and beyond for a customer.
✨Know the Products Inside Out
Familiarise yourself with the products offered by the retailer. Be ready to discuss their features, benefits, and any technical details that may come up during the interview. This will demonstrate your commitment and knowledge.
✨Demonstrate Organisational Skills
Since the role involves managing multiple tasks, be prepared to discuss how you prioritise and organise your workload. Share specific strategies or tools you use to stay on top of your responsibilities.
✨Prepare Questions for the Interviewer
Show your interest in the role and the company by preparing thoughtful questions. Ask about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or how success is measured in the Sales Advisor position.
